Vitiligo is a condition in which the melanocytes (pigment producing cells) are destroyed. As a consequence, white patch or blotches appear on the skin in different parts of the body.

Hypopigmentation is the unusual lack of skin color which is caused by diminution in melanin. Hypopigmentation often associated with albinism, vitiligo or serious injury.
Vitiligo causes loss of pigment and due to loss of pigment no protection against sun rays is left. Melanin (pigment that gives color to the skin) helps in protecting our skin from harmful UV rays of sun.
